Clippers sign Kobe Sanders to standard contract

Summary by Daily Breeze
The Clippers signed promising rookie Kobe Sanders to a standard contract, officially making him part of the team’s 15-man roster. The second-round draft pick from Nevada had been on a two-way contract. Sanders was approaching the 50-game cap for a two-way player, having appeared in 43 NBA games this season.
